Research on sub healthy evaluation index selection of college students based on Delphi Methodology
In this paper we studied the health status of college students from the physiological and psychological aspects, and determined the evaluation indexes of sub healthy status in college students. Firstly, by using the literature analysis method, referring to the internationally recognized five health scales (EQ-5D, CSHS, SF-36, WHOQOL-100 and sub healthy status questionnaire), the relevant factors of College Students' physical and mental sub healthy were found out, and an items pool of candidate indicators of College Students' sub healthy was established. Then, using Delphi method, experts were invited to compare and judge the indicators of items pool and screen them to select reasonable and effective sub healthy evaluation indexes items. As a result, according to the indexes screening criteria, after two rounds of expert consultation, 7 first-class indicators and 54 second-class indicators were determined. Among them, 7 first-class indicators were physiological function, energy, exercise ability, physical symptoms, psychological cognition, emotion and psychological symptoms. The selected indicators can better respond to the actual needs of college students and meet the needs of constructing the sub healthy evaluation indexes scale for college students, so as to comprehensively evaluate the health status of college students and carry out accurate health management and service.
